At the India-EU Business Summit in New Delhi, President of the European Council and Prime Minister of Britain Tony Blair said, "The future clearly belongs to opening up of the economies. Globalization is not a matter of debate, it is a reality."
Blair also dispelled fears about job losses in developed countries due to outsourcing. He said that the outsourcing of business processes actually boosted the profits of local business houses. Blair added that outsourcing was here to stay, as it helped economies of the developed countries.
